Strategies for Planning

Tips for early planning:
- Survey residents, families and staff - In 1991, Teresian House conducted surveys of residents, families and staff. Many transformations were based on resulting comments and assessments.
- Evaluate strengths and weaknesses of multiple aspects of the organization - Teresian House evaluated the physical environment, staff and resident policies, care practices, and social interactions.
- Define or redefine mission and goals - Sister Pauline and her staff wrote mission statements and created goals to support personal and organizational missions.
- Focus on areas of concern and create solutions - A steering committee studied dementia care and created the Dementia Program Pilot.
- When embarking on change, involve all stakeholders - Teresian House held regular meetings with staff, families and residents to discuss environmental changes.
- Create an organizational structure with the resident at the center (see above Teresian House Organizational chart).
